Good Evening
Looking for a sauce recipe and was unable to find what I wanted. So made up one from ideas garnered from recipes on the internet.

Result:
1 1/2 cups cider vinegar
1/2 cup ketchup
1/2 cup water
1 tbs sugar
1 tsp salt
1/3 tsp hot mustard.

Combine all in saucepan and simmer for 8 - 10 minutes. Let cool and enjoy. Will last about a week in the fridge. Make extra so you have some to last a week.
